Output d6ce80e15523a0b73e9bdcf72f3daf10a212d1e9451a5341f58d6c45895033a1:1

value
20035256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c90fadc7c207c051d70668ac61c80500829f94 OP_EQUAL
address
3KSwsjpaVB4eYeitqjzwxtWTiDxaM73W3e
transaction
d6ce80e15523a0b73e9bdcf72f3daf10a212d1e9451a5341f58d6c45895033a1
spent
true